Man arrested for arson at disabled youth holiday facility in the Netherlands

Friday, 8 May 2026, 07:00 · 1 min read

A 33-year-old man from Berg en Dal has been arrested in connection with a fire that destroyed a holiday facility belonging to Stichting Wigwam (a Dutch foundation that organises holidays for young people with disabilities) in Heel, a village in the southern province of Limburg. The building had been in use for just five days when it was set alight on the night of 21–22 April; forensic investigation confirmed arson earlier this week. The suspect, who reportedly escaped from a closed institution for people with intellectual disabilities, is said to have talked openly with his caregivers, who then alerted police — and he subsequently confessed to the fire, as well as a second arson, telling investigators he derives pleasure from setting fires. The foundation's director stressed the attack was random and not directed at the organisation.
